7. Killing Ra’s al Ghul

Itโs honestly amazing that an old bastard Raโs al Ghul chilled out as much as he did by the time Infinite Frontier rolled around. He and his grandson Damian Wayne got along really well, with Raโs even briefly mentoring Damian. But things took a turn for the worse in the โShadow Warโ crossover when Raโs was killed. Now ordinarily thatโs not a problem, but this death vaporized him and seemingly made resurrection impossible. Now Raโs is a specter, bonded to Damianโs girlfriend Flatline, with seemingly no way to return to the land of the living.
6. Locking Two-Face’s Good Side Away

After reading comics for so long, it becomes tough to watch Two-Face trying to go straight. His most recent attempt was in his self-titled All In miniseries. He put his legal mind to good use settling affairs in the criminal underworld. But, as is usually the case, Harvey Dentโs Two-Face personality had other plans in mind. He launched a coup for control of the body, succeeding and locking Harvey away, seemingly permanently. Itโs so sad watching someone who clearly wants to do good, never able to overcome their worst half.
5. Condemning Bane to Hell

We all like to think redemption is possible, but for Bane, it really isnโt. Secret Six featured an arc where Bane went to Hell on a mission, only to discover that he was destined for eternal damnation. Despite the strict code of honor heโs adhered to, it isnโt enough, and Bane will indeed go to Hell when he shuffles off the mortal coil. And when you rob a guy like Bane of hope, you canโt be surprised when he decides to go full villain again and not even try to become a better person.
